安装方法网上有非常多,随便搜一篇https://blog.csdn.net/w410589502/article/details/77850955
安装完成后,环境也配置好了,出现问题:
输入java -version,显示的jdk版本还是自带的OpenJDK1.8.0
嘿,我这暴脾气。
怀疑是环境变量的问题,想到之前windows出现过装两个版本的jdk,配置环境变量的时候出现的问题,https://blog.csdn.net/weixin_42451493/article/details/81004238
在配置环境变量的时候,把$JAVA_HOME放到前面呢???
也就是
export JAVA_HOME=/usr/java/jdk1.8.0_152
export CLASSPATH=.:$JAVA_HOME/jre/lib/rt.jar:$JAVA_HOME/lib/dt.jar:$JAVA_HOME/lib/tools.jar
export PATH=$PATH:$JAVA_HOME/bin %改掉
%改成
export PATH=$JAVA_HOME/bin:$PATH
记得source /etc/profile让它生效
再java -version一次,成功了!